A decision on Musharraf’s Impeachment
The coalition parties have at last announced a firm plan to go for an impeachment of Pervez Musharraf and reinstating the deposed judges of country’s superior courts. This decision will strictly take place according to the resolution passed in Murree declaration. This most awaited announcement was made in a joint communiqué.
PPP co-chairperson Asif Ali Zardari in a news conference read the decision. Zardari called this settlement as “good news for democracy.” He said, “The coalition has decided that it will immediately initiate impeachment proceedings against General (Retd) Musharraf.” A charge sheet would be soon presented in the parliament, he added. Regarding required majority in the parliament for impeachment of the president Musharraf he stated that the coalition has the power and the required votes.
